Fast WordPress Issue Resolutions: A Detailed Tutorial

Experiencing difficulties with your WordPress site ? Don't panic ! Many common WordPress glitches can be simply resolved with a few straightforward steps. This explanation provides a hands-on approach to resolving frequently encountered problems. First, examine your plugins – a faulty plugin is a frequent culprit. Deactivating all plugins and then re-enabling them one by one helps identify the offending one. Next, inspect your theme; a incompatible theme can also lead to issues. Switch to a standard WordPress theme (like Twenty Twenty-Three) to see if the error disappears. If those approaches don’t work the matter , increase your PHP resource – regularly a small adjustment can do a big change. Finally, don't forget to clear your browser's cookies.

  • Turn off all plugins.
  • Try a default theme.
  • Adjust your PHP memory limit.
  • Clear your browser cache.
